区块链:理解其含义、工作原理及应用前景

            时间:2025-03-23 11:58:20

            主页 > 加密圈 >

                  
                      

                  区块链的定义

                  区块链是一个分布式数据库或账本技术,其特点是具有去中心化、透明性和不可篡改性。它的基本结构由一系列“区块”组成,这些区块通过密码学技术相互连接,形成一个链条。每一个区块都包含了一组交易记录和一个时间戳,以及前一个区块的加密散列(hash)。这种设计使得任何已添加到链中的数据不可被修改,也避免了单点故障的问题,极大地增强了系统的安全性和稳健性。

                  区块链的工作原理

                  区块链的工作原理可以分为几个关键步骤:

                  1. **交易生成**:当两方进行交易时,交易信息被生成并广播到网络中。

                  2. **交易验证**:网络中的节点(即计算机)会对交易进行验证,确保交易的有效性。这通常涉及到对交易发起者的身份进行验证,以及确保其有足够的资产进行交易。

                  3. **打包交易**:经过验证的交易会被打包成一个区块,准备写入区块链。这一过程通常由一些被称为“矿工”的节点完成,他们使用计算能力进行复杂计算,以确保区块的有效性。

                  4. **区块添加**:验证通过后,新区块将被添加到现有链的末尾,并广播到整个网络,确保所有节点更新各自的账本。

                  5. **历史记录**:每个节点都保存着完整的区块链副本,使得历史交易记录透明且不可篡改。

                  区块链的主要类型

                  区块链可以按不同的标准进行分类,主要有以下几种类型:

                  1. **公有链**:任何人都可以参与的区块链,如比特币和以太坊,具有高度去中心化的特点。

                  2. **私有链**:由特定组织或集团控制的区块链,通常用于内部管理或特定用途,安全性较高。

                  3. **联盟链**:由多个组织共同管理的区块链,适合需要多个信任方协作的场景。

                  4. **侧链**:与主链平行的区块链,可以通过某种机制与主链交互,通常用于实验性项目。

                  区块链的实际应用

                  区块链技术的应用领域广泛,主要包括:

                  1. **金融**:区块链最初被视为一种新的支付方式,特别是在加密货币领域。此外,它还可以用于跨境汇款、智能合约和资产证券化等。

                  2. **供应链管理**:通过区块链追踪商品从生产到销售的全过程,确保信息透明,提升供应链效率,降低欺诈风险。

                  3. **医疗**:在医疗行业,区块链可以用来安全地存储病历数据,确保患者隐私,同时允许多方访问,促进信息共享。

                  4. **投票系统**:利用区块链技术可实现安全、透明的投票过程,防止选票篡改,提升投票的公信力。

                  5. **身份认证**:区块链可以用于提升个人身份验证的安全性,减少身份欺诈的风险。

                  区块链的优势与挑战

                  区块链技术的优势包括:

                  1. **去中心化**:不再依赖于中介,降低了交易成本和风险。

                  2. **透明性**:所有交易记录都是公证的,增强了信任。

                  3. **不可篡改性**:一旦数据被加入区块链,就不能被伪造或删除,提供了安全保证。

                  然而,区块链也面临着一些挑战,包括:

                  1. **可扩展性**:随着用户和交易量的增加,区块链的处理速度可能变慢。

                  2. **能源消耗**:尤其是Proof of Work(工作量证明)类型的区块链,其运算过程需要大量能量。

                  3. **法规不确定性**:各国对区块链和加密货币的监管政策尚不明确,可能影响技术的推广和应用。

                  可能相关的问题

                  区块链与传统数据库的区别是什么?

                  尽管区块链与传统数据库都用于数据存储和管理,但它们有几个根本性的区别。首先,传统数据库通常由中心化的管理系统控制,任何数据的修改均需要管理员权限,而区块链则是去中心化的,任何节点都有权验证和记录交易。其次,传统数据库更新速度快,但数据一旦修改便不可追溯,区块链在添加数据后不可篡改,但数据的处理速度相对较慢。此外,区块链通过密码学技术确保安全,传统数据库则依赖于防火墙和加密等保安措施。

                  区块链技术如何改变金融行业?

                  区块链技术正在深刻改变金融行业的多个方面。首先是在资金转移方面,区块链提供了比传统银行系统速度更快、费用更低的跨境支付解决方案。其次,智能合约使得合约执行过程自动化,无需中介,从而降低交易成本。此外,区块链还能提供透明的审计流程,增强金融产品的合规性和安全性,降低欺诈的风险。最后,区块链的去中心化性质允许用户更好地掌控自己的资产,推动金融普惠的发展。

                  区块链在供应链管理上的应用效果如何?

                  在供应链管理领域,区块链技术的应用有效解决了传统管理中的信息不对称和透明度不足的问题。通过区块链,可以实时追踪产品从原材料采购到最终消费者的每一步,确保所有参与方免费看到真实的交易记录,提高透明度。同时,区块链能够验证产品的来源,有效防止伪造商品流通。此外,它还可以减少中介环节,缩短供应链时间,降低管理成本,提升整体效率。

                  智能合约是什么?它们如何与区块链结合?

                  智能合约是一个自执行的合约,合约条款以代码形式写入区块链中。当合约条件被满足时,合约将自动执行,相当于数字化的合约执行。智能合约与区块链结合的主要优点在于:它们不需要中介进行管理,从而减少了交易成本;执行过程透明且可追溯,确保合约的可信性;同时因为合约的执行依赖于预设的程序,减少了因主观因素导致的争议。

                  区块链的未来发展方向怎样?

                  区块链的未来发展方向可能会集中在以下几个方面:首先是可扩展性和效率的提升,研究者们致力于解决区块链在处理交易时的速度和存储问题。其次,更多的行业将会探索区块链的应用,如医疗、能源和房地产等。此外,区块链技术的合规性和监管政策将日益重要,各国政府将推动政策的建立以促进技术健康发展。最后,随着更多企业和投资者的关注,区块链的商业模式和生态系统将逐渐成熟,可能会出现新的商业案例和技术突破。

                  此内容为概述,若要达到4000字的详细阐述,需要更深入和扩展的内容,涵盖更多的案例分析、最新研究进展、市场趋势等,确保足够的字数和信息丰富度。